Discover top Lowick attractions with your pet

Lowick, nestled near the charming town of Berwick-upon-Tweed, is a fantastic base for pet-friendly adventures. Explore the stunning Northumberland National Park, where you and your furry friend can roam freely along picturesque trails, taking in breathtaking views of the Cheviot Hills. Just a short drive away, the expansive sandy beaches of Berwick are perfect for a day out; allow your dog to frolic in the waves while you enjoy a leisurely stroll along the coast. For a dash of culture, visit the nearby Etal Castle, where history meets scenic gardens, and pets are welcomed in the grounds. The local pubs and cafés often have outdoor seating, so you can enjoy a meal with your pet by your side. What pet-friendly activities should we do in Lowick?
The best pet-friendly activities in Lowick centre around its extensive network of footpaths and the nearby Northumberland coast.For dog owners, exploring the local footpaths is a must. Many trails start directly from the village, offering opportunities for long walks through the countryside. The paths are generally well-maintained and provide plenty of open space for dogs to run and explore. You'll find signposted routes leading to nearby hamlets and scenic viewpoints.The Northumberland coast, just a short drive from Lowick, offers several dog-friendly beaches superb for a day out. Beaches like Bamburgh and Holy Island allow dogs year-round, though some restrictions may apply in summer months for specific sections. Your dog can enjoy running on the sand and playing in the sea, while you take in the impressive coastal scenery and historic castles.
